Why Concrete goes to the Center of the Green Building Revolution



Concrete has actually long been the foundation-- literally-- of building and construction. From bridges and walkways to homes and skyscrapers, it's almost everywhere. Yet standard concrete manufacturing is resource-intensive and responsible for a significant quantity of global carbon discharges. As awareness expands and regulations shift, the market is under pressure to innovate.



This is where eco-friendly concrete is available in. It isn't about changing concrete completely, but instead boosting it. Home builders, engineers, and developers are discovering ways to make it more reliable, much less dangerous to the environment, and a lot more aesthetically appealing.



What Makes Concrete Eco-Friendly?



Green concrete is designed to lower its carbon footprint while still doing like conventional blends. Some methods make use of recycled products such as smashed glass or slag from industrial waste. Others include carbon capture strategies, lessening discharges during manufacturing. There are even concrete types that can absorb pollution from the air, helping to clean city settings.



Yet sustainability does not stop with ingredients. It also consists of durability. Environmentally friendly mixes often last longer and resist weathering, which suggests less repair work and replacements down the line. That makes them not simply an eco-friendly choice, however a clever financial investment.

Urban Planning and Green Infrastructure



As cities look towards the future, eco-friendly materials are ending up being essential. Towns are incorporating lasting concrete right into sidewalks, public plazas, and even stormwater monitoring systems. Due to the fact that environmentally friendly concrete can be engineered for permeability, it helps reduce runoff and support natural groundwater recharge-- two big wins for urban locations managing frequent flooding and water lacks.

The Role of Local Sourcing and Waste Reduction



In the past, building often counted on materials delivered over fars away, enhancing emissions and costs. With environment-friendly concrete, a lot of the raw products can be sourced in your area, reducing transport impacts. In addition, utilizing commercial by-products like fly ash or recycled accumulations assists divert waste from garbage dumps and gives new life to what would certainly or else be disposed of.



It's a circular method to building-- utilizing what we currently have in smarter means, conserving resources, and developing resilient structures that serve their areas well.
